Instant AI Coding Quiz Generator: Test Programming Mastery
Stop manually crafting syntax questions. Upload your syllabus, codebase snippets, or simply prompt the AI to instantly generate high-fidelity, adaptive coding quizzes optimized for active recall.
No credit card required
Trusted by learners from top universities
From Raw Material to Validated Assessment in Minutes
Leverage specialized AI models trained on technical assessment standards to ensure your practice tests are relevant, challenging, and accurate.
Convert Code Snippets & Concepts to Exams
Upload PDFs of documentation, raw text files, or even images containing algorithms. The AI intelligently parses technical requirements, data structures, and complexity theory.
Algorithmic Accuracy & Detailed Explanations
Every generated multiple-choice option includes a complete explanation detailing why the correct answer is accurate and why distractors are flawed—essential for deep learning.
Export for Any LMS or Offline Use
Ensure seamless integration into your study schedule or platform. Export quizzes in production-ready formats like PDF, DOCX, QTI 2.1, or Moodle XML.
Build Your Next Technical Exam in Three Simple Steps
Our process ensures that the resulting knowledge checks precisely match the content you provide, maximizing study efficiency.
- 1
Step 1: Input Your Source Material
Upload your course notes, textbook chapters, presentation slides, or simply type a detailed prompt like: 'Create 10 questions on recursive data structures in C++.'
- 2
Step 2: AI Intelligence Deploys
Our specialized generation engine scans the input, extracts core knowledge points, and constructs multiple-choice questions focusing on syntax, logic, and algorithmic complexity.
- 3
Step 3: Practice, Refine, and Export
Review the generated quiz in our interactive mode, simulating focused testing. Once satisfied, export your validated assessment package immediately.
Why Use an AI Coding Quiz Maker for Technical Subjects?
Creating rigorous coding quizzes that test genuine understanding, not just memorization, is time-consuming. Generic online resources rarely align with proprietary course material or specific technical stacks. Our AI quiz maker bridges this gap by turning your exact source documents—whether they cover Python syntax, advanced database queries, or complex algorithmic proofs—into reliable formative assessments.
- Ensures coverage of niche topics found only in your internal documentation.
- Generates high-quality distractors that mimic common programmer mistakes.
- Facilitates rapid creation of targeted practice sets for technical interviews.
Stop relying on static question banks. Utilize the power of artificial intelligence to guarantee that every practice session directly targets your current learning objective.
Explore related topics
Frequently Asked Questions About AI Quiz Generation
Get the details on how our AI processes your technical content and delivers structured exams.
How does the AI generate questions from my coding documents?
The AI uses advanced Natural Language Processing (NLP) combined with code analysis techniques. It identifies key terms, function definitions, theoretical concepts (like Big O), and relationship statements within your text or code, formulating questions that test comprehension and application.
What types of files can I upload to create a coding quiz?
We support uploading common document formats, including PDF, DOCX, and PowerPoint presentations (.pptx). You can also input images containing diagrams or highlighted text. For direct concept input, simply paste raw text or code blocks into the prompt field.
Can I export the generated quiz for offline use or import into a learning management system?
Yes, export options are robust. You can download ready-to-print PDFs and editable Word (DOCX) files. For academic platforms, we fully support exporting in QTI 2.1 format and Moodle XML for easy import.
Is the AI quiz maker free to use, or is there a paid tier?
The tool offers a generous free tier allowing you to test its capabilities immediately. The paid plan unlocks significantly more generation credits per month and grants access to our most advanced, high-context AI model for superior results on complex technical topics.